The Position & Animation of the Steps:



So, for the animation, I took the spline again that I used at the very beginning.  I placed a first step at the bottom of the escalator and then applied a "path constraint” on the step.


Fig. Animation Steps

Fig. Path Constraint

I duplicated the step and changed the value of the “Along Path”.  Between two steps, I set a distance of 2,4.  So, the first is at 47,3 and the following step is at 49,7.  I repeated this action for each step of the escalator.
